Flutter Web 应用程序在发送带有 body 的 GET 请求时遇到错误

问题描述 投票:0回答:1

我目前正在开发

a Flutter web application
,我遇到了问题,特别是在尝试发送带有正文的 GET 请求时。该应用程序在 Chrome 上按预期工作,但在发送此特定请求时,我始终收到一条错误,指示主体为空

我尝试使用

HTTP
Dio
包,并且还添加了
' Access-Control-Allow-Origin'
标头来处理跨源问题,但问题仍然存在。是否有已知的解决方法或解决方案可以成功地在 Flutter Web 应用程序中使用正文发送 GET 请求?任何见解、代码示例或替代方法都会非常有帮助。谢谢!

flutter dart http
1个回答
0
投票

您不能(或至少不应该)发送带有获取请求的正文参见。 http 包无法做到这一点 see 和 dio 也see

如果你想用get请求发送数据,你应该使用查询参数。

© www.soinside.com 2019 - 2024. All rights reserved.